Kejriwal declared `Six Guarantees’ of INDIA alliance

Delhi Chief Minister Aravind Kejriwal, who is now under ED custody, presented six guarantees on behalf of the INDIA bloc, including granting statehood to Delhi.  Addressing the INDIA bloc’s mega rally at Ramlila Maidan, condemning the arrest of Delhi CM Arvind Kejriwal in the money laundering case registered in connection with the liquor policy scam, his wife Sunita Kejriwal read out his message.

“I present six guarantees on behalf of INDIA Alliance. First, there will be no power cuts in the whole country. Second, electricity would be free for the poor people. Third, we will make government schools in every village. Fourth, we will set up Mohalla Clinics in every village, we will establish a multi-speciality government hospital in every district and everyone will get free treatment. Fifth, farmers would be given the correct price for the crops. Sixth, the people of Delhi have faced injustice for 75 years. We will give statehood to Delhi,” he said the message.

Kejriwal said all the six guarantees will be fulfilled within five years and added he has made all planning for funding these guarantees. Sunita asserted that the Aam Aadmi Party leader is a lion and the BJP would not be able to keep him in prison for long.

Sunita said, “Our Prime Minister Narendra Modi put my husband in jail, did the Prime Minister do the right thing? These BJP people are saying that Kejriwal ji is in jail, he should resign. Should he resign? Your Kejriwal is a lion, they will not be able to keep him in jail for long.”

Sunita Kejriwal read a message from the Delhi chief minister, currently in Enforcement Directorate’s custody at the rally. She, quoting him read, “I am not asking for votes today. I invite 140 crore Indians to make a new India. India is a great nation with thousands of years old civilisation. I think about Mother India from inside the jail and she is in pain. Let’s make a new India.”
